Christus patient <Latin> / Christ's Passion (1608) is a play by Hugo Grotius.

Abstract

A classical Latin drama by the renowned jurist, philosopher and biblical scholar. Among the characters were Jesus of Nazareth, Judas Iscariot, Peter, Pontius Pilate, and Joseph of Arimathea.

Editions, performances, translations

Published in 1608. In 1640, translated into English by poet George Sandys (1578-1644).
